Student-Produced Documentary Takes Third Place at Michigan Film Festival

February 8, 2007

Movie Reel Film.jpgFebruary 8, 2007, Greencastle, Ind. - Returning from Iraq: War Zone to Workplace -- a documentary produced by current DePauw University seniors Andrea Dres, Adam McClean, Lindsay Morris and Teddy Tutson, and 2006 graduate Jenny Morrissey -- took third place in the college division of Michigan’s Muskegon Film Festival last weekend. The 30-minute film, produced in the fall of 2005 as part of Professor Ken Bode's "Documentary Television" course, examiness the issues American veterans face after returning home from the war as told from the perspective of a National Guard veteran. The student film also earned a third placeaward at Cleveland's Indie Gathering Film Festival in August 2006.
